  • Responsibilities

    • The Senior Accountant will report to the Controller and is responsible for supporting day to day accounting as well as month end close and reporting, inventory accounting, as well as serving as a key business partner between the finance and operations teams

    • Revenue Recognition

    • Manage intercompany transactions 

    • Cost accounting - Provide cost of goods analysis

    • Assign account codes to items such as invoices, vouchers, expense reports, check requests, etc. with correct codes conforming to standard procedures to ensure proper entry into the financial system

    • Receives, researches and resolves a variety of routine internal and external inquiries concerning account status, including communicating the resolution of discrepancies to appropriate persons.

    • Prepare month end inventory and cost of goods sold valuation for both manufacturing and retail facilities

    • Record bi-weekly payroll

    • Assist in compiling information and preparing responses to auditors during the annual external audit

    • Ensure transactions are allocated accurately and timely

    • Responsible for analyzing any significant month over month fluctuations in the financial statements

    • Work with operations to help implement departmental budgets

    • Produce budget variance reports and analysis

    • Assist with forecasting, cash planning and management

    • Assist and collaborate with the administrative team on monitoring and reporting for expense reimbursement and debit card transactions.

    • Collaborate with controller to process vendor payments

    • Prepares check requests, wire transfers, and ACH transactions for processing

    • Prepare memos, reports and financial analysis using Word and/or Excel as needed

    • Work directly with the Controller on projects and serve as a backup for other accounting functions and their reporting needs

    • Maintain files and documentation thoroughly and accurately, in accordance with company policy and generally accepted accounting principles

    • Other duties as assigned and required
